Hmmm - Who is in charge of the web pages? http://thoughtso.org/2012/02/14/wordpress-google-cache-poisoning/ and other pages mention php files being touched/changed by 3rd parties. Also, saw a reference to mangling in "footer.php". if ( !(strpos($sUserAgent, 'google') == false)) and other lines like that may be an issue - made to look ok for normal users, but google cache gets a different version John A.
